Associate applicants have rated the interview process at Boston Consulting Group with 3.7 out of 5 (where 5 is the highest level of difficulty) and assessed their interview experience as 70% positive. To compare, the company-average is 66.5% positive. This is according to Glassdoor user ratings.
Candidates applying for Associate roles take an average of 52 days to get hired, when considering 66 user submitted interviews for this role. To compare, the hiring process at Boston Consulting Group overall takes an average of 40 days.
Common stages of the interview process at Boston Consulting Group as a Associate according to 66 Glassdoor interviews include:
One on one interview: 39%
Skills test: 18%
Personality test: 10%
IQ intelligence test: 9%
Presentation: 8%
Phone interview: 6%
Background check: 5%
Other: 4%
Group panel interview: 1%
Drug test: 1%

I applied online. The process took 3 weeks. I interviewed at Boston Consulting Group (London, England) in Oct 2011
Interview
2, 45 minute interviews with principles in the IT and Public Sector practices. Was grilled quite intensely on my decision to shift from strategic planning consultancy to commercial consulting. First case involed a P&L for a mortgage company, with basic quants, and a discussion on potential future sale and ownership structures. Second case format was Mckinsey style from ex-Mckinsey consultant and was very qualitative.
I interviewed at Boston Consulting Group (Chicago, IL)
Interview
Round 0 had an assessment, round 1 had 1 case with a human then 1 case with a chatbot. The cases weren’t too complicated mostly revolving around profitability and break even pricing, but the subject matter was niche.
